Offer description

We are seeking a results-oriented and strategic Talent Acquisition Business Partner to collaborate with our agency partners, HR and business teams in identifying, attracting, and retaining top talent.

Working as part of a best-in-class HR function, the Talent Acquisition Business Partner will be responsible for developing and executing effective sourcing strategies to support professional recruitment, managing the end-to-end process including assessment centres, and partnering with business leaders to understand their recruiting needs and objectives.

This is a hands-on role for an experienced practitioner who is tech-savvy, delivery-focused, and committed to building the strong foundations needed to sustain excellence to support the NWF mission and wider people strategy as the organisation continues to scale.


Key Accountabilities

* Strategic Planning: Work closely with the wider HR team and the business to develop recruitment strategies, including assessment of working with agency or using campaign strategies for recruitment.
* Talent Acquisition: Identify, source, and attract top talent through various channels, including job boards, social media, professional networks, and referrals. Where assessed as appropriate, partner with agencies on recruitment campaigns.
* Full-Cycle Recruitment: Manage the entire recruitment process, from developing job descriptions and conducting interviews to making job offers and onboarding new hires.
* Partner with Agencies: Work with our agency partners on recruitment campaigns, briefing requirements, managing liaison with hiring managers, supporting interviews and offer processes.
* Candidate Assessment: Design and run assessment centres. Across all recruitment activity, conduct in-depth candidate assessments, including interviews and skills testing, to ensure the selection of highly qualified candidates.
* Employer Branding: Promote our employer brand and create compelling job postings and recruitment marketing campaigns.
* Data Analysis: Use data and analytics to track recruitment metrics, evaluate the effectiveness of recruitment strategies, and make data-driven recommendations for improvement.
* Relationship Building: Build strong relationships with hiring managers and business leaders to understand their headcount requirement needs and act as a trusted advisor.
* Compliance: Ensure compliance with all relevant employment laws and regulations throughout the recruitment process.
* Diversity and Inclusion: Promote diversity and inclusion in all aspects of the recruitment process and advocate for diversity initiatives within the organisation.


Experience

* Proven experience as a Talent Acquisition Business Partner or similar role in a fast-paced environment managing multiple roles and recruitment strategies.
* Experience of working in a Financial Services or Professional Service organisation is highly desirable.
* Strong understanding of talent acquisition best practices and current recruitment trends.
* Proven experience in supporting an organisations EDI strategy, building local and diverse talent pipelines and networks.
* Proficiency in using applicant tracking systems (Workday preferred) and other industry recruitment tools such as LinkedIn.


Skills

* Exceptional organisational, communication and analytical skills to provide insights to drive recruitment strategy.
* Uses judgement to build strong collaborative relationships across all levels.
* Excellent communicator and interpersonal skills.
* Flexible and adaptable; able to work in ambiguous situations, purposeful with high levels of resilience.
* Ability to think across the organisation, a keen eye for detail whilst focusing on the execution.
* Problem solving, influencing and awareness of trends and best practice externally.
* A collaborative approach, growth mindset and coachable.
* Knowledge of employment laws and regulations.
* CIPD qualified or equivalent experience.
* Degree level or equivalent.
* Strong in MS Office applications: Outlook,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
